52 providers in Cardiac Anesthesiology, Diabetic Kidney Disease, Gynecologic Oncology, Laboratory Medicine

52 providers in Cardiac Anesthesiology, Diabetic Kidney Disease, Gynecologic Oncology, Laboratory Medicine